Listen to the note carefully and try to … Web9 Feb 2024 · 1. Introduction. Humans intuitively pair high-pitched sounds with small objects and low-pitched sounds with large objects. This phenomenon is referred to as the pitch-size crossmodal correspondence and is just one of a number of low-level crossmodal correspondences discovered in humans to date. Web10 Apr 2024 · The pitch of a note is how high or low it sounds. Pitch depends on the frequency of the fundamental sound wave of the note. The higher the frequency of a sound wave, and the shorter its wavelength, the higher its pitch sounds. But musicians usually don't want to talk about wavelengths and frequencies.

Uptalk is a speech pattern in which phrases and sentences habitually end with a rising sound, as if the statement were a question.
